Popularly known as Luneta Park, Rizal Park is Manila's most iconic urban central park on Roxas Blvd in Malate. Specially dedicated to Jose Rizal- the Filipino nationalist and freedom fighter- the park's highlight is the central Rizal Monument that houses the mortal remains of Jose Rizal. The urban park is one of Asia's largest green spaces.

Under Spanish rule, the public park known as Rizal Park was called Bagumbayan. It was later dubbed Luneta Park by the locals and is still widely called Luneta, despite the change of name in the 1950s. This beautiful central park is a 60-hectare (148-acre) space of open green lawns, ponds, paved walks, ornamental gardens, and wooded areas.

The picturesque park overlooks the Manila Bay. This park is very near to the Intramuros and was built in order to prevent sneak attacks from the patriotic natives. The park has seen some of the most important moments in history of Philippine. These include the execution of the great Philippine hero, Dr. Jose Rizal on December 30, 1896.
